Virgin Atlantic has officially launched the Virgin Atlantic Passport Challenge on the Strava platform, a dynamic worldwide movement encouraging participants to turn fitness activities into premium travel rewards. Designed to inspire a focus on health, this digital initiative offers exciting perks within the Virgin Red loyalty ecosystem.
The challenge kicked off on May 6, inviting individuals to track their physical activities and contribute to a vibrant community of fitness-minded travelers. How the Virgin Atlantic Passport Challenge Works
The challenge operates on a simple premise: log miles and earn rewards! The competition will run through June 3, granting participants the chance to win an impressive 1 million Virgin Points. These points translate into various rewards, from flights between the US and UK to stays at Virgin Hotels or adventures with Virgin Voyages.
This initiative specifically targets residents and visitors in bustling cities like New York City and Los Angeles. Curated Strava segments within these urban environments help users navigate their fitness journeys while maximizing their point earnings. Community Engagement with a New York City Run
The launch of the Passport Challenge is paired with exciting community events, including a fun run scheduled for May 28 in New York City, starting from Virgin Hotels New York. The event will be led by Laura Watts, a Flight Service Manager and an ultra-marathon enthusiast. Featuring professional crew members in these activities humanizes the brand, showcasing genuine investment in this healthy lifestyle initiative.
The run will traverse iconic landmarks, ensuring a scenic experience while participants log their fitness achievements. Virgin Atlantic’s cabin crew will support the event, providing hydration and the chance to win prizes. Additionally, the Everdene Terrace at Virgin Hotels New York will serve as a recovery lounge, equipped with advanced wellness technology from Exhale Spa, including features such as compression boots and Theraguns.
Enhancing Wellness Before and During Flights
Virgin Atlantic’s commitment to prioritizing traveler wellness carries through to amenities at significant international hubs. At LAX, the Zen Den invites passengers to take part in mindfulness sessions led by FORME Studio. Meanwhile, London Heathrow boasts Somadomes for immersive meditation experiences, ensuring travelers leave grounded and ready for their journeys.
Onboard, this wellness-focused narrative continues, especially in the Upper Class cabin, where travelers enjoy lie-flat seats and curated social spaces designed for relaxation and connection.
